08:10 AM EST, 01/06/2025 (MT Newswires) -- Southwest Airlines ( LUV ) , American Airlines ( AAL ) and United Airlines (UAL) were among the US carriers that canceled flights early Monday due to Storm Blair, FlightAware data showed.
As of 8 am ET Monday, 1,446 flights within, into, or out of the US have been canceled while nearly 800 flights were delayed, according to FlightAware.
Southwest ( LUV ) canceled 362 flights, American Airlines Group ( AAL ) had 176 canceled flights while United and Delta Air Lines ( DAL ) canceled 78 and 39 flights, respectively, FlightAware said.
Southwest ( LUV ), American Airlines ( AAL ), United, and Delta also issued travel advisories warning clients that services may be disrupted due to the storm.
